In the realm of mechanical engineering, various components play critical roles in ensuring the functionality and efficiency of machinery. Among these components, the closed type thrust bearing holds significant importance. A closed type thrust bearing is a specialized type of bearing designed to support axial loads while minimizing friction and wear. This particular design features a sealed structure that prevents the ingress of contaminants, thereby enhancing its durability and performance. One of the primary applications of the closed type thrust bearing is in heavy machinery, such as turbines and generators, where it is essential to manage immense forces exerted in a single direction. The closed nature of this bearing type allows it to maintain a consistent level of lubrication, which is crucial for reducing heat generation during operation. Unlike open bearings, which are more susceptible to dirt and debris, the closed type thrust bearing ensures that the internal components remain clean and well-lubricated, leading to a longer service life. Furthermore, the design of the closed type thrust bearing often incorporates advanced materials that enhance its load-bearing capacity and resistance to wear. For instance, many manufacturers utilize composite materials or specially treated metals that can withstand high temperatures and pressures. This innovation not only improves the performance of the bearing but also contributes to the overall efficiency of the machinery in which it is installed.The installation and maintenance of a closed type thrust bearing require careful consideration. Engineers must ensure that the bearing is properly aligned and secured to prevent premature failure. Additionally, regular inspections are necessary to check for any signs of wear or damage. If any issues are detected, timely replacement or repair can prevent costly downtimes and extend the lifespan of the equipment.
